The Texas A&M men?™s swimming and diving team opened its season with a hard fought loss to the University of Missouri in dual meet action at Gabrielsen Natatorium on the Iowa State University Campus. The Aggies fell to the Tigers 132-111.
Texas A&M head coach Jay Holmes weighed in on the Aggies?™ performance. ?We did some good things and we found a lot of things we need to work on, but the bottom line is we need to win. We just didn?™t get that done today.?
The Aggies swam to victory in both relays and returning Big 12 champion Israel Duran won the 200 meter fly but it wasn?™t enough to hold off the hard-charging Tigers.
Jay Holmes and company will return to action tomorrow as they take on Texas and Missouri in the Big 12 Relays which will also be held on the Iowa State campus in Ames.
